ruby-on-rails - 更改 Rails 中的文件夹名称 - Git 不允许我添加到提交

标签 ruby-on-rails github

alt text

引用上面的屏幕截图,我更改了树中最低级别文件夹的名称。例如,我将“Chips”更改为“chips”。奇怪的是,当我尝试将以下命令添加到提交时,Git 拒绝识别它:

git add public/images/chips/

将文件添加到提交的唯一方法是在子文件夹中添加实际文件。

有什么想法如何处理吗?

最佳答案

通常,在更改文件或目录名称时,您需要使用以下内容:

git mv oldfile newfile

这将告诉 git 实际添加更改,以便您可以提交它们。因此,尝试手动将其更改回来

mv chips Chips

然后运行

git mv Chips chips

关于ruby-on-rails - 更改 Rails 中的文件夹名称 - Git 不允许我添加到提交,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4028053/

相关文章:

ruby-on-rails - 如何覆盖 Rails 中验证错误中的 html 格式?

git - 为与 master 完全无关的代码创建分支不是很奇怪吗?

android - Android Studio 中分离的 HEAD 问题

GitHub:权限被拒绝(公钥)。 fatal: 从 GitHub 克隆目录时远程端意外挂断

android - 无法将Android Studio项目推送到Github

ruby-on-rails - 必须将捆绑执行添加到 rake db :migrate

ruby-on-rails - 当我在 ruby​​ 中使用系统命令创建 TAR 时出现错误 "tar: Invalid transform expression"。为什么?

ruby-on-rails - Sidekiq 列出所有作业 [已排队 + 正在运行]

ruby-on-rails - 这个语法如何检查请求格式?

templates - GitHub:Template 和 Fork 概念之间有什么区别以及何时使用?